Le P'tit Rustik earns high marks for generous portions, flavorful dishes and a warm, welcoming atmosphere that makes brunch feel special. Reviewers consistently praise eggs Benedict, French toast and bognettes, along with crispy potato fritters and fresh sides, and many highlight standout items like pain doré and shakshuka. The vibe is cozy and convivial, with attentive staff and fast service in many visits, though crowds can make the space feel cramped and weekend lines long. The terrace is a popular option in good weather, and several guests note easy street parking nearby. Prices tend to be on the higher side, but the quality and portion sizes often justify the cost. Occasional service hiccups during peak hours and slow follow up can disappoint some diners, but the overall sentiment is very positive and Le P'tit Rustik is regarded as a must try brunch spot in Montreal.

Hands down the best brunch I've ever had. We all ordered a version of the Benedict-I had the classic, while the others went for the braised veal Benedict-& every bite was insanely flavorful. The eggs were perfectly poached, the hollandaise was flawless with just the right balance of acidity, & everything was beautifully seasoned. The potato bognettes were mind-blowing as well: easily the most satisfying potatoes I've ever had, crispy on the outside with an almost mochi-like texture on the inside. Truly an unforgettable brunch.
